Imperial Oil Ltd 2015 SR

The report highlights Imperial Oil's 2015 performance in safety, environment, and community investment. The company achieved its best-ever workforce safety performance and reached record-low spill counts. Environmental initiatives included recycling 80 percent of water at the Kearl oil sands operation and investing $195 million in research and technology. Total greenhouse gas emissions rose to 13.1 million tonnes of CO2e, primarily due to increased cogeneration, while emissions intensity at key operations decreased. Imperial also invested $27 million in Canadian communities and spent $329 million with indigenous businesses.
